The Sputnik Moment Down Under

The original Sputnik moment in 1957 galvanised the US into unprecedented investment in science and technology. Today, AI's rapid advancement, described by the NY Times Opinion as America's 'own kind of Sputnik', should similarly jolt Australia awake. Our nation has a proud history of technological innovation, from Wi-Fi to the bionic ear. Yet, consistently translating early-stage research into market-leading industries has proven challenging.

The global AI landscape is evolving at a breathtaking pace, with Australia having the potential to carve out niche strengths. Areas like AI in healthcare, agriculture, and mining – sectors where Australia already holds global expertise – could become fertile ground for AI innovation. However, this demands a concerted national strategy, significant investment, and a willingness to confront bureaucratic inertia. Without it, the vast economic and societal benefits of AI could bypass our shores.

Fuelling the Innovation Engine

One of the key lessons from the NY Times Opinion analysis of the US's AI success is the symbiotic relationship between venture capital, academic research, and entrepreneurial drive. Australia's venture capital ecosystem, while growing, remains nascent compared to global powerhouses. Attracting and retaining top AI talent, fostering interdisciplinary research, and providing pathways for commercialisation are paramount.

The Australian government has made some strides with initiatives aimed at boosting STEM education and attracting global talent. However, the scale of investment and the urgency of implementation need to be recalibrated against the backdrop of the global AI arms race. Estimates suggest that the global AI market could reach over AUD $250 billion by 2027, representing a colossal economic opportunity. Failing to secure a significant slice of this pie would have long-term repercussions for Australia's prosperity and global standing.

Avoiding the Brain Drain and Building Capacity

A persistent challenge for Australia has been retaining its brightest minds. World-class AI researchers and developers are highly sought after globally, often lured by significantly higher salaries and more abundant research opportunities abroad, particularly in the US. This 'brain drain' could cripple Australia's ability to build a sustainable AI industry.

To counter this, a multi-pronged approach is required. This would include increased funding for university AI research programs, incentives for Australian start-ups, and the creation of attractive career pathways for AI professionals within Australia. Furthermore, public-private partnerships will be crucial in translating cutting-edge research into practical, economically viable applications. The alternative is a future where Australia becomes a consumer of AI developments rather than a contributor, reliant on overseas innovations and potentially compromising our national sovereignty in critical technological areas.
